Anders Nedergaard is a scholar working on Physiology, Cell Biology and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Anders Nedergaard has authored 13 papers receiving a total of 622 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Physiology, 7 papers in Cell Biology and 5 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Anders Nedergaard’s work include Muscle metabolism and nutrition (6 papers), Muscle Physiology and Disorders (5 papers) and Nutrition and Health in Aging (4 papers). Anders Nedergaard is often cited by papers focused on Muscle metabolism and nutrition (6 papers), Muscle Physiology and Disorders (5 papers) and Nutrition and Health in Aging (4 papers). Anders Nedergaard collaborates with scholars based in Denmark, United States and Norway. Anders Nedergaard's co-authors include Kim Henriksen, M.A. Karsdal, Shu Sun, Claus Christiansen, Charlotte Suetta, Qinlong Zheng, Michael Kjær, Peter Schjerling, Mette Juul Nielsen and Sanne Skovgård Veidal and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, The Journal of Clinical Endocrinology & Metabolism and European Journal of Applied Physiology.
